Transaction 3085c77bb64b12ddebc8bb0fb5653622ceffa3ba2755087d63b6c7a8cd5ca4a5

2 Input
2 Outputs
  • 3085c77bb64b12ddebc8bb0fb5653622ceffa3ba2755087d63b6c7a8cd5ca4a5:0
  • value  966669
    address  1PcbXArX4DnhrrKHzqGZTSpLJHTNf5SCs1
  • 3085c77bb64b12ddebc8bb0fb5653622ceffa3ba2755087d63b6c7a8cd5ca4a5:1
  • value  221376
    address  17Cnmm64k8NMPSwR9bCaHV9ZWcwk2piH5w